Description:
This is a fine quality small antique English Georgian chest of drawers, constructed of solid mahogany, with a brushing slide, circa 1790 and later, in excellent condition. The chest has been reduced in size at some point in the past, probably to make it fit into a particular space in a house. The chest comprises a straight mahogany top, above a brushing slide and bank of four graduated drawers. The solid mahogany brushing retains its original pierced drop handles, while the drawers also boast their original brass swan neck handles and shaped escutcheons. The drawers are oak lined, constructed with hand dovetail joints and finished with cock beaded fronts. They also retain their original working locks, with working key. The bottom section terminates on a simple moulded apron, terminating on its original bracket feet. The chest retains its original backboards. Having small proportions, this chest is easily transportable upstairs and is ideal for a landing or a smaller bedroom, where a larger chest would take up too much space. This item is solid in joint and ready to use.
